Chapter Eighteen
They pulled into Pack lands just after dark, and instead of pulling up to the main house, Kane drove past it down a road to a smaller log cabin style house nestled among some trees. He parked in a garage and shut off the engine, his hands clutching the steering wheel, belying his tension. They sat quietly for a long moment until he broke the silence.
âI know youâre worried about staying here and about the mating. I wonât press you about either, but my wolf might not allow me to let you go.â
His tone was filled with his regret, but his look showed his determination. He saw her as his mate, and that wasnât going to change, even as he was determined to provide her the time she needed to decide for herself. He was trying, which wasnât easy for a dominant shifter male. Besides, the more time she spent with him, the less she wanted to leave his side, which shouldâve made her want to run as fast as she could. But somehow, she wanted to stay, wanted to spend more time with him.
The low buzz of arousal that had been between them in the couple of days since theyâd met had been building, and she suspected it would intensify the longer she spent in his company. Their kiss had exploded the passion between them and made her want to explore the bond she could feel getting stronger. The physical connection was definitely there, and her body urged her to go all in, but she needed more. He seemed prepared to provide it. The more he respected her and treated her as an equal, the more the woman in her wanted to see if the bond she could sense developing between them was true. Perhaps, they could be partners in a true sense.
A part of her screamed at her to run, to not trust. Sheâd been betrayed too many times to trust anyone again. But another part of her said to trust her feelings, to trust what sheâd already seen. Kane was the real deal, though it had only been a couple of days. Despite him being a shifter, he still wanted her in his life. She thought back to what the healer had said, or rather what her mother had said through the healer. Maybe it was time to take a chance.
She reached across and laid her hand on his. âIâm not going anywhere, Kane. Not now.â
He froze. âI think thatâs the first time youâve used my name.â
She thought back, guilt making her flush. âMaybe I have been a little hard on you. Iâm sorry.â
âIâm worried about my sister and my Pack. I could use your help.â
She got out of the jeep and walked around to the driverâs side. She opened his door and held out her hand. âWeâve got this. Iâm here for you. Ready?â
He took her hand and got out of the jeep. âAs Iâll ever be.â
They went inside and Kane flipped on the lights. Sheridan was immediately enchanted by the interior.
